Harmonic Feedback - Tara Kelly I read a portion of this last year before getting swamped with other issues and having to put it off for far too long. So I won't give it a star score yet. But what I did read was AMAZING. This is the most realistic account of a girl with an incredibly high-functioning case of Asperger Syndrome that I've ever come across, and yes, she reminds me intensely of my teen self. (Interesting that I used to be more like Caitlin of "Mockingbird" and am now on the level of Drea; reading these two books can give a pretty good illustration of how the symptoms of Asperger Syndrome can lessen over time!) Definitely worth a look for all aspie girls. I look forward to reading the rest of it soon.
